#190c44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#190c44 is composed of 9.8% red, 4.7%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.2% cyan, 82.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 253.9 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 15.7%. #190c44 color hex could be obtained by blending #321888 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#190c44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#190c44 has RGB values of R:25, G:12,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 1641540.

Shades and Tints of #190c44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f3f0f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#190c44
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#282828 is the less saturated color, while #14034d is the most saturated one.
